What companies run services between Berlin Central Station, Germany and Wittenbergplatz, Germany?

S-Bahn Berlin operates a train from Berlin Hbf to S+U Zoologischer Garten Bhf every 5 minutes. Tickets cost €2–3 and the journey takes 6 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from S+U Berlin Hauptbahnhof to Wittenbergplatz via U Bülowstr. and U Wittenbergplatz in around 27 min.
